WECRD board recall petition deemed valid (Local News ~ 07/27/17)
Petitions aimed at recalling two of the Western Elmore County Recreation District's directors continues to move forward after the county elections office verified that both petitions contained enough valid signatures. In April, a group of citizens known as the Friends for Recreation launched the recall petition with the stated purpose to remove board president Art Nelson and board vice president Judy Mayne from their elected positions... -
Back-to-school registration set to begin next week (Local News ~ 07/27/17)
Registration for the 2017 to 2018 school year in the Mountain Home School District begins with online signups Aug. 2 and in-person registration following at most district schools Aug. 3. Most schools in the district will open from 8 a.m. to noon and again from 1 to 4 p.m. for in-person registration, although the district encourages parents to register returning students using the online option... -
School board officers selected as academic year nears (Local News ~ 07/27/17)
The Mountain Home school board started the new academic year by electing its district officers before moving on to the business of preparing for the arrival of students in August. Elected officers include board chairman Eric Abrego and vice-chairman Ralph Binion with Sharon Whitman continuing as the district clerk... -
